c语言用函数求N个整数中被五整除的最大正数存在就返回
来源:学生作业帮助网 编辑:作业帮 时间:2024/07/03 10:34:59
#include"stdio.h"intgys(intm,intn){if(n>1){if(m%n!=0){returngys(n,m%n);}elsereturnn;}}intmain(){intm
楼上是C++写的,这个是C语言版的#include#includeintmain(){intcount;int*arrayLenth;int**intArray;int*elem1,*elem2;in
#includevoidsx(intx[],intn){inti,j,t;for(i=0;i
以3×4的矩阵为例:#includemain(){inta[3][4];inti,j,s;printf("Inputsomenumbers:\n");for(i=0;i
假设是用a数组存放的数据intsum=0,i,num=0,average;for(i=0;i
递归的时候逻辑有点混乱,你看这样写是不是更好#includeintgcd(intm,intn){intg;g=m%n;if(0==g){returnn;}else{returngcd(n,g);}}i
#include <stdio.h>#define SIZE 5int main(){ int&nbs
#include#includemain(){inti,k,t=0,n,max,min,sum=0;scanf("%d",&n);scanf("%d",&k);if(k%2==0){t++;sum+=
因为你用整数1那么默认的就是int型而不是double型第二个参数算出来也就是个int而不是doublepow是个重载函数会进行类型匹配的如果类型写错了会调用不同的函数的
#include <stdio.h>int calculate_mode(int number [],int n)//求众数{\x09in
double类型的输出使用%lfl为字母L的小写.如果用%f输出double,往往输出0.再问:还是不对!你可以在oj.jzxx.net上提交一下程序,先注册,题号1180,将程序复制进去即可。
#includeintStrchr(chars[],charch){intl,i;intj=0;l=strlen(s);for(i=0;i
intn,a,s,ifor(i=0,s=0;i
#includevoidmain(){intn,s=1,a;scanf("%d",&n);while(n--){scanf("%d",&a);if(a%2==0)s*=a;}printf("%d",s
#includeintmain(){inta,sum=0;while(scanf("%d",&a))sum+=a;printf("sum=%d\n",sum);return0;}再问:数是从键盘上输入
#include<stdio.h>void main(){\x05int *fun(int *,int,int);\x05int a[20],*p;
设计程序:求N乘N矩阵的边线元素和.元素的值是两位整数,用rnd()函数产生printf("边界元素之和为:%d",sum);#include"stdio.h"
intN(intx){if(x==0){return1;}else{returnx*N(x-1)}}intiRet=0;for(inti=1;i
C++版本:#includeusingnamespacestd;intmain(){intcas;while(cin>>cas){intn,p,q;intarr[1000];while(cas--){
inti,a,n;int*pl=NULL;printf("inputn:");scanf("%d",&n);if(n>0){pl=(int*)malloc(n*sizeof(int));}for(i=